UPDATE: Bridge inspection will happen on Diversion Dam bridge starting at 10 a.m. today
BOISE - To beat the winter weather that is forecast for tomorrow, the inspection of the Diversion Dam bridge on Idaho 21 east of Boise has been moved up and will happen today (Tuesday, Jan. 17), resulting in a lane closure at the bridge, the Idaho Transportation Department announced.
Weather
permitting, bridge inspection crews will perform the routine inspection from 10
a.m. to 4 p.m., and the northbound lane will need to be closed in that
area during the work. Flaggers with two-way radios will assist
travelers.
The unique curved-steel-girder bridge was built in 1996. It is in good condition, and is on a two-year inspection cycle. Here's a picture of the bridge.
